Summary:Hierarchical resource is one of the two means of administrative supervision provided for in Canon law, and is to challenge an administrative to hierarchical superior, circumstance that implies its processing by the same administrative procedural in which it was issued. The competent superior has conferred sweeping powers in order to received hierarchical resource resolution
